2004 Bombadier Outlander 400 HO charging problem
My budy has this quad he put a new battery in last week and now it is dead. There is an almost broken wire that hooks to the battery and the selenoid could it be that or could it be the stator. The quad runs great other than that any help would be appreciated

Replace that wire, check all other connection to and from the battery, and make sure the cables at the terminals are TIGHT...
You wouldnt imagine all the weird and crazy stuff that a loose connection will do on these things..
I would say it is the broken wire.... Or a bad battery... Stators generally are good on these things, but it being an older model, I am not sure...
Start with the broken wire and go from there....

BRP had a problem with the voltage regulater in the 04 Outlanders, first problem it was located in the front, it got to hot, they put it in the back, by the battery, still not good, they have a larger one to replace the one they put in the back, it fixed the problem.
